aboutsummaryrefslogtreecommitdiffstats
AgeCommit message (Expand)AuthorFilesLines
2014-09-07setup.py: Check for Python 3 and for use of entry pointsAndy Lutomirski1-7/+12
2014-09-07Add setup.pyVincent Batts1-0/+25
2014-09-07Move most files into the virtme package or the guest-tools directoryAndy Lutomirski10-11/+13
2014-09-07virtme-run: Stop using the inspect moduleAndy Lutomirski1-3/+1
2014-09-07Move run.py into a new virtme.commands packageAndy Lutomirski2-7/+11
2014-09-07Move the meat of virtme-run into a moduleAndy Lutomirski2-372/+382
2014-09-07Add virtme and virtme.commands packagesAndy Lutomirski2-0/+0
2014-09-07Add DCO 1.1Andy Lutomirski1-0/+32
2014-09-03Rename virtme_stty_console to virtme_stty_conAndy Lutomirski2-3/+3
2014-09-03Factor more console init into arch codeAndy Lutomirski2-15/+34
2014-08-27Improve busybox search and show an error if it failsAndy Lutomirski2-8/+24
2014-08-27virtme-run: Factor out is_nativeAndy Lutomirski1-2/+3
2014-08-27Add aarch64 supportAndy Lutomirski2-1/+37
2014-08-27Factor virtio device naming into arch-specific codeAndy Lutomirski2-10/+27
2014-08-25virtme-run: Post-merge fixesAndy Lutomirski1-10/+6
2014-08-25Merge Xen supportAndy Lutomirski1-4/+20
2014-08-12Add prereqs.configAndy Lutomirski2-0/+38
2014-08-12virtme-run: Quote kernel arguments correctlyAndy Lutomirski1-2/+13
2014-08-12README.md: Document architecture supportAndy Lutomirski1-0/+11
2014-08-12virtme-run: Canonicalize virtme-run's pathAndy Lutomirski1-2/+2
2014-08-11virtme-init: Implement virtme_chdirAndy Lutomirski1-0/+4
2014-08-11virtme-udhcpc-script: Switch to bashAndy Lutomirski1-1/+1
2014-08-11architectures: Add a watchdog timerAndy Lutomirski1-3/+8
2014-08-11Check for access to /dev/kvm, not just presenceAndy Lutomirski1-1/+1
2014-08-11virtme-run: Revert incorrectly added debugging codeAndy Lutomirski1-1/+0
2014-08-11Add preliminary support for virtme tools installed in the guestAndy Lutomirski2-7/+22
2014-08-11Add support for architecture-specific configurationAndy Lutomirski2-10/+79
2014-08-11Set -no-reboot in script modeAndy Lutomirski1-0/+3
2014-08-11virtme-run: Fix script modeAndy Lutomirski1-0/+2
2014-08-11Only use initramfs if needed and add debugging optionsAndy Lutomirski2-27/+68
2014-08-11Fix various initramfs-less and merge bugsAndy Lutomirski2-17/+15
2014-08-11Merge changesAndy Lutomirski2-11/+47
2014-08-11virtme-run: Add (disabled) support for initramfs-less bootAndy Lutomirski1-8/+18
2014-08-11virtme-run: Set psmouse.proto to speed up bootAndy Lutomirski1-0/+3
2014-08-11Fix virtme-init to work without initramfsAndy Lutomirski2-16/+22
2014-08-11Pass virtme_init's path using init=Andy Lutomirski2-12/+30
2014-08-11Change the root mount_tag from virtme.root to /dev/rootAndy Lutomirski2-2/+5
2014-07-21Add --busybox to override the path to busyboxAndy Lutomirski2-3/+17
2014-07-21Initial support for --rootAndy Lutomirski2-7/+25
2014-07-21virtme-run: Refactor virtfs export codeAndy Lutomirski1-2/+5
2014-07-14virtme-run: Add Xen supportAndy Lutomirski1-8/+18
2014-06-21README: Improve console docs a bitAndy Lutomirski1-0/+2
2014-06-21README: Document --consoleAndy Lutomirski1-0/+6
2014-06-21Improve default --console settingsAndy Lutomirski2-1/+19
2014-06-21mkinitramfs: Pass command-line arguments throughAndy Lutomirski1-1/+1
2014-06-15README.md: Improve KVM textAndy Lutomirski1-1/+1
2014-06-15Merge commit 'refs/pull/1/head' of github.com:amluto/virtmeAndy Lutomirski1-1/+2
2014-06-15virtme-run: If /dev/kvm is missing, don't set -cpu hostAndy Lutomirski1-1/+3
2014-06-14README: add KVM to the list of requirements for a host.Ivan Krasin1-1/+2
2014-04-16modfinder: Don't fail if a requested module is built inAndy Lutomirski1-5/+10
2014-04-13virtme-run: Get rid of virtio-rngAndy Lutomirski1-1/+0
2014-04-03xfstests sample: Fix spelling of SCRATCH_MNTAndy Lutomirski1-4/+4
2014-04-03Add a sample xfstests driver.Andy Lutomirski3-0/+50
2014-04-03virtme-run: Add --diskAndy Lutomirski1-3/+21
2014-04-03virtme-run: Only add a balloon if --balloon is specifiedAndy Lutomirski1-2/+5
2014-04-01virtme-init: Turn off virtme-loadmodsAndy Lutomirski1-4/+2
2014-04-01virtme-run: Split --script into --script-exec and --script-shAndy Lutomirski1-7/+27
2014-04-01Request script executing via initramfs instead of via the kernel command lineAndy Lutomirski3-12/+16
2014-04-01virtme-run: Move mkinitramfs to the endAndy Lutomirski1-11/+9
2014-04-01mkinitramfs: Make configuration more flexibleAndy Lutomirski3-10/+18
2014-04-01Add script modeAndy Lutomirski2-3/+70
2014-04-01virtme-loadmods: Deduplicate modaliasesAndy Lutomirski1-1/+1
2014-04-01Merge branch 'master' of ssh://ra.kernel.org/pub/scm/utils/kernel/virtme/virtmeAndy Lutomirski5-14/+65
2014-04-01README.md: UpdateAndy Lutomirski1-2/+5
2014-04-01mkinitramfs.py: Finish migrating logging to kmsgAndy Lutomirski1-10/+15
2014-04-01Add basic networking supportAndy Lutomirski3-0/+34
2014-04-01virtme-run: Add real support for kernel argumentsAndy Lutomirski1-2/+11
2014-03-31virtme-loadmods: Rewrite in shAndy Lutomirski1-53/+16
2014-03-31Log to kmsg instead of the console when possibleAndy Lutomirski3-8/+32
2014-03-31virtme-run: Add --console to run headlessAndy Lutomirski1-0/+17
2014-03-31virtme-run: Improve device defaultsAndy Lutomirski1-0/+3
2014-03-31virtme-init: Rearrange a little and overmount /etc/fstabAndy Lutomirski1-1/+11
2014-03-31Improve module loadingAndy Lutomirski2-4/+64
2014-03-31virtme-run: Fix a commentAndy Lutomirski1-1/+1
2014-03-31mkinitramfs.py: Clarify some formattingAndy Lutomirski1-2/+2
2014-03-29virtme-run: Improve default devicesAndy Lutomirski1-0/+4
2014-03-29virtme-init: Run udev even if devtmpfs is availableAndy Lutomirski1-5/+5
2014-03-29Pass modules through to the guest, if applicableAndy Lutomirski2-2/+20
2014-03-29Update README.mdAndy Lutomirski1-10/+9
2014-03-29Remove virtme-runkernelAndy Lutomirski1-23/+0
2014-03-29virtme-run: Don't require a nonexistent kmod versionAndy Lutomirski1-7/+15
2014-03-29Merge virtme-run and suchAndy Lutomirski3-45/+120
2014-03-29virtme-init: Mount tmpfs over /var/logAndy Lutomirski1-0/+1
2014-03-25Update for tentative kmod changes.Andy Lutomirski3-45/+120
2014-02-27Change the mount tag of the root to virtme.root.Andy Lutomirski2-2/+2
2014-02-19Add more modules and document allmodconfig issuesAndy Lutomirski2-3/+22
2014-02-19Improve module loading heuristicsAndy Lutomirski3-20/+26
2014-02-19mkinitramfs.py: Bail if mounting root failsAndy Lutomirski1-0/+1
2014-02-18Add basic support for digging modules out of a build kernel treeAndy Lutomirski2-0/+34
2014-02-18Split virtme-mkinitramfs into an executable and a Python scriptAndy Lutomirski2-104/+119
2014-02-17virtme-mkinitramfs: Add basic module configurationAndy Lutomirski1-6/+38
2014-02-12Fix various cases of device node confusionAndy Lutomirski2-5/+13
2014-02-12cpiowriter: Fix mkchardevAndy Lutomirski1-1/+1
2014-02-12virtme-mkinitramfs: Improve the broken-virtfs workaroundAndy Lutomirski2-3/+4
2014-02-12Add a fallback to support QEMU 1.4 and 1.5Andy Lutomirski3-23/+44
2014-02-07virtme-mkinitramfs: Add preliminary support for modulesAndy Lutomirski2-0/+72
2014-02-06Add basic modprobe diagnostics.Andy Lutomirski2-8/+36
2014-02-06Improve behavior on Ubuntu and update the docsAndy Lutomirski3-4/+15
2014-02-06Improve startup logging and fix some creatively broken mount commandsAndy Lutomirski2-2/+3
2014-02-06cpiowriter: Add missing copyright and license noticeAndy Lutomirski1-0/+6
2014-02-06README.md: Add links to virtme's homeAndy Lutomirski1-0/+6
2014-02-06Update README.md and fix copyright years.Andy Lutomirski4-3/+8
2014-02-06Initial commit of virtme.Andy Lutomirski7-0/+612